JS数组的各种排序示例
  ①冒泡排序 
  bubbleSort:function(array){
   var i = 0, len = array.length, j, d; for(; i<len; i++){ 
  for(j=0; j<len; j++){ 
  if(array[i] < array[j]){ 
  d = array[j]; array[j] = array[i]; array[i] = d; 
  } 
  } 
  }
   return array; }
  ②js 利用sort进行排序 
  systemSort:function(array)
  { return array.sort(function(a, b)
  { return a - b; }); 
  },

  ⑤ 插入排序 
  insertSort:function(array){
  / /var array = [0,1,2,44,4,324,5,65,6,6,34,4,5,6,2,43,5,6,62,43,5,1,4,51,56,76,7,7,2,1,45,4,6,7]; 
  var i = 1, j, temp, key, len = array.length; 
  for(; i < len; i++){ 
  temp = j = i; key = array[j]; while(--j > -1){ 
  if(array[j] > key){ array[j+1] = array[j]; }else{ break; 
  } 
  }
   array[j+1] = key; 
  } return array; 
  }
